What I Looked For in a Drill Bit Holder
The first thing I considered was storage capacity. I wanted a holder that could fit the sizes I use most often without taking up too much space. I also checked how securely the bits stayed in place, because I didn’t want them falling out while moving the holder around.
Material Quality Matters to Me
I found that the material makes a big difference in durability. Plastic holders are lightweight and affordable, but I prefer metal or heavy-duty options when I want something long-lasting. If I’m using it on a jobsite, I look for a holder that can handle wear and tear without cracking or bending.
Portability and Convenience
I like drill bit holders that are easy to carry and simple to access. Some attach directly to a belt, drill, or tool bag, which saves me time when I’m working. If I’m moving from one project to another, portability becomes one of my top priorities.
Compatibility With My Drill Bits
Not every holder fits every type of bit, so I always check compatibility before buying. I make sure it can hold the sizes and styles I use most, whether they are standard twist bits, driver bits, or specialty bits. A holder that matches my tools helps me stay organized and efficient.
Storage Style I Prefer
I’ve seen holders with trays, cases, magnetic slots, and clip-on designs. My choice depends on how I work. For home use, I like compact cases. For active projects, I prefer a clip-on or magnetic holder because it keeps my bits within easy reach.
Ease of Use Is Important
I don’t want to waste time fighting with a complicated holder. I look for one that lets me remove and replace bits quickly. A smooth, user-friendly design helps me stay focused on the job instead of dealing with storage issues.
Price vs. Value
I’ve learned that the cheapest option is not always the best value. I compare price with durability, capacity, and convenience. Sometimes paying a little more gives me a holder that lasts longer and works better, which saves money in the long run.
